Thanks Kevin. I am reviewing the proposal from Genesys now. What are the typical annual recurring costs I should be looking at? Is there typically an annual per port charge from the PBX vendor (Nortel/Avaya) and per seat charges for CTI (Genesys), along with per port charges for GVP (Genesys)?
I can only speak from my experience as an end-user, so anyone who is an integrator, feel free to add your remarks.
Regarding Genesys, we pay an annual maintenance amount which is a percentage of the list price of the products we have (generally the licensed seats and ports).
Since the PBX question could have a number of different answers based on whether the switch is owned, leased, or hosted, and whether it is managed internally or through a third party, I would recommend you speak with the Telecom team for the company in question to find out what one-time and recurring costs could be associated with this implementation.
